Overview

Defensin beta 103B (DEFB103B) is a human gene from the defensin family, which encodes small cationic peptides with potent, broad spectrum antimicrobial activity against bacteria, viruses, and fungi. Defensins, including DEFB103B, are produced mainly by epithelial cells and neutrophils and contribute critically to innate immunity by disrupting microbial membranes and modulating immune responses. DEFB103B (also known as Beta-defensin 3 or hBD-3) has a role in chemotaxis, epithelial barrier function, and regulation of cell death. It is implicated in host defense against infection, inflammatory diseases, and some cancer contexts. While there is interest in developing defensin-derived therapeutics, safety concerns include toxicity to host cells and the potential to exacerbate inflammation. DEFB103B is classified as an antimicrobial peptide, not as a classical receptor, enzyme, or transporter[1][2][3].

Mechanism of action

For experimental defensin-based therapies, mechanisms involve: Membrane disruption through pore formation (barrel-stave, toroidal pore, carpet models); Immune modulation and chemotaxis enhancement[2]
